The design “alphabet” of Mazandaran kilims was originally created by the talented women of Mazandaran, Iran, in the late 19th to early 20th century. The minimalist patterns and stripes in these kilims, resembling a design alphabet, offer endless possibilities for rearrangement, inspiring the creation of new and innovative designs.
